Tips

To further enhance Tommy's learning experience, consider incorporating regular discussions about budgeting for family groceries, allowing him to practice these skills consistently. Engage him in simple activities like 'price matching' games at home or during grocery trips. Introduce him to books that explain economic concepts in a child-friendly manner, and encourage outdoor observations of seasonal changes in nature. You could also organize visits to local farmers' markets, where he can engage directly with producers and see the impact of environmental factors on prices and availability.
